Mar 16, 2017 · A reduced order model of rectangular micro channel counter flow heat exchanger is developed in which it is transformed into a hydrodynamically and thermally equivalent parallel plate micro heat exchanger. To improve the accuracy of the model, correction factors obtained from detailed computational fluid dynamics model are introduced.
Dec 21, 2020 · M icrochannel heat exchangers (MHEs) are widely used in automotive engineering. MHEs can be divided into tiny MHEs (TMHEs) and large-scale MHEs (LMHEs) by size. LMHEs are mostly used in air-conditioning systems. They are almost parallel flow heat exchangers. Mar 05, 2015 · Microchannel heat exchangers are widely used in air conditioning and refrigeration systems because of their compactness and enhancement for heat transfer performance. However, microchannel heat exchangers can perform even better if distribution is further improved, especially when used as evaporators. The UGKS Simulation of Microchannel Gas Flow and Heat Oct 05, 2020 · Abstract The unified gas kinetic scheme (UGKS) is introduced to simulate the near transition regime gas flow and heat transfer in microchannel confined between isothermal and nonisothermal parallel plates. The argon gas is used and its inlet Knudsen number (Kn in) ranges from 0.0154 to 0.0715.
